How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Physical Education from St. Andrews Cost?

$29,680 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

St. Andrews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at St. Andrews was $400 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$28,680 $28,680
Fees $1,000 $1,000
Books and Supplies $2,100 $2,100
On Campus Room and Board $10,300 $10,300
On Campus Other Expenses $6,754 $6,754

Does St. Andrews Offer an Online BS in Physical Education?

St. Andrews does not offer an online option for its phys ed b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the St. Andrews Online Learning page.
